The climatic conditions in the southern region are more suitable for the growth of potatoes, and the growth cycle is about 3 to 4 months. Compared to other crops, potatoes have a shorter growth cycle and can be harvested faster, thus improving economic benefits. So how many times a year can potatoes be planted in the south? Two-crop planting In most parts of the south, such as the Yangtze River Basin, potatoes can usually be planted twice a year, once in spring and once in autumn. Spring planting generally takes place from January to February, while autumn planting takes place around September. 2. Three-crop planting In some areas with warmer climates and longer frost-free periods, such as Yunnan and Guangxi, potatoes can even be planted three times a year. This is thanks to the fact that these areas provide more time and suitable temperature conditions for potato growth. 2. Potato planting methods in the south 1. Seed potato processing Choose healthy, pest-free seed potatoes and cut them into 25 to 30 g pieces, making sure each piece has eyes. The cut seed potato pieces should be soaked in hot water for 30 to 40 minutes before sowing. After cutting, dip the cut surface with wood ash to prevent the wound from becoming inflamed by the wind. 2. Select the site and apply fertilizer Potatoes prefer moderate moisture, but too much water can cause root rot. Therefore, before planting, make sure the soil is well drained and avoid waterlogging. Apply an appropriate amount of organic fertilizer , such as well-rotted farmyard manure, before planting to improve soil fertility. At the same time, you can also add an appropriate amount of compound fertilizer or potassium fertilizer as base fertilizer. 3. Planting seeds Bury the seed potatoes evenly in the soil to a depth of about 25 cm, with a distance of 3-5 cm between the seed pieces. After filling, water it in time to ensure that the water can penetrate to the bottom of the soil and keep the soil moist. Cover the soil surface with a layer of plastic film to keep it warm and moist. 4. Field management During the growing period, the plant needs to be watered every 3-5 days to meet its growth needs. Pay attention to replenishing nutrients in time and keeping the soil moist. In the early stages of growth, the soil should be watered and fertilized, and weeding should be carried out in a timely manner.
